Toll manufacturing or tolling is outsourcing all the production or part of it to a third-party company where you provide all the raw materials or semi-finished products. The work of the third-party company is to process the products or raw materials to the required specification.
The only drawback to toll manufacturing is that it adds to the overhead of managing logistics. This can be complicated since you have to synchronize the delivery of the raw materials with the production schedule of the tolling company.
Toll manufacturing involves taking responsibility over specific stages of the production process. The customer retains ownership of the raw materials and other components used by the manufacturer in the production process.
To recap, toll blending involves the business providing the raw materials to the manufacturer. Toll blending may involve the customer providing all or some percentage of product materials. Conversely, turnkey contract manufacturing allows the business to rely on the manufacturer to source the product materials.
The main difference is that contract manufacturers are hired by other companies to produce items on their behalf. Manufacturers can either produce finished products intended for the end user/customer, or they can make components that are used to manufacture other products.
In toll manufacturing, the customer owns the materials and the products, while in other types of contract manufacturing, the manufacturer owns them or shares them with the customer. This means that the customer bears the risk of material loss, damage, or spoilage, as well as the market fluctuations and demand changes.
Contract structure: There are different types of contract manufacturing agreements to choose from. This category includes private label manufacturing, contracts for manufacturing individual components or parts, labor or service subcontracting, and end-to-end service contracts.
